From 65fa8d57b466b2a087f01fd87affb8b2ee4d3932 Mon Sep 17 00:00:00 2001 From: Pranav K Date: Fri, 12 Apr 2019 11:31:27 -0700 Subject: [PATCH] Translate VSTS Git urls to GitHub URLs Possible fix for https://github.com/aspnet/AspNetCore/issues/7710 --- Directory.Build.targets | 29 +++++++++++++++++++++++++++++ 1 file changed, 29 insertions(+) diff --git a/Directory.Build.targets b/Directory.Build.targets index efafc9f288..e90a905671 100644 --- a/Directory.Build.targets +++ b/Directory.Build.targets @@ -98,6 +98,35 @@ + + + + + + + <_Pattern>(https://dnceng%40dev\.azure\.com/dnceng/internal/_git|https://dev\.azure\.com/dnceng/internal/_git|https://dnceng\.visualstudio\.com/internal/_git|dnceng%40vs-ssh\.visualstudio\.com:v3/dnceng/internal|git%40ssh\.dev\.azure\.com:v3/dnceng/internal)/([^/-]+)-(.+) + <_Replacement>https://github.com/$2/$3 + + + + $([System.Text.RegularExpressions.Regex]::Replace($(ScmRepositoryUrl), $(_Pattern), $(_Replacement))) + + + + + $([System.Text.RegularExpressions.Regex]::Replace(%(SourceRoot.ScmRepositoryUrl), $(_Pattern), $(_Replacement))) + + + +